WebFeb 8, 2024 · With a solid economic base, a lower cost of living, and plenty to do in the city as well as the nearby communities, Columbus is good for families, young professionals, and college students alike. Crime, especially in recent years, has been a deterrent to moving to Columbus, and bad weather can also be a nuisance at various times of the year.
